Does Autophagy eat fat cells: what to track and how to measure progress

What Is Autophagy and Does It Target Fat Cells?

I often hear confusion around autophagy. This natural cellular cleanup process does not directly "eat" fat cells. Instead, autophagy breaks down damaged cell parts, recycles proteins, and improves metabolic efficiency. When practiced through intermittent fasting or extended fasts, it supports fat oxidation by shifting your body into using stored fat for energy once glycogen depletes. In my experience with clients aged 45-54 managing diabetes and blood pressure, this process helps reduce inflammation that contributes to joint pain and stubborn hormonal weight gain.

During autophagy, your body prioritizes clearing dysfunctional mitochondria and misfolded proteins. Fat loss occurs as a secondary benefit when insulin levels drop low enough to unlock fat stores. Studies show 16-18 hours of fasting can initiate measurable autophagy, while 24-48 hours intensifies it. Practical Ways to Trigger Autophagy Without Overwhelming Your Schedule

For beginners who've failed every diet, start with a daily 16:8 intermittent fasting window—eat between 12pm and 8pm. This requires no complex meal plans. Focus on whole foods rich in polyphenols like green tea, berries, and olive oil to enhance autophagy. Avoid snacking, as even small carbs spike insulin and pause the process. If joint pain limits exercise, gentle walking after your eating window supports the metabolic shift without strain.

Track your fasting with a simple phone app. Note energy levels, joint comfort, and how clothing fits rather than daily weigh-ins. Many in their 50s notice reduced blood pressure readings within 4 weeks as autophagy improves insulin sensitivity. What to Track and How to Measure Real Progress

Don't rely solely on the scale, which fluctuates with water weight. Instead, measure waist circumference weekly—aim for 1-2 inches lost per month. Monitor fasting blood glucose if you have diabetes; drops of 10-15 points signal improved metabolic health from autophagy. Use a ketone meter or urine strips to confirm nutritional ketosis (0.5-3.0 mmol/L blood ketones), which often overlaps with autophagy.

Other markers include better sleep, less joint stiffness in the morning, and stable energy without afternoon crashes. In The CFP Reset, I teach the "Three Non-Scale Victories" journal: energy, mood, and mobility. Photograph your progress monthly. For hormonal changes in perimenopause, track cycle symptoms or hot flash frequency—these often improve as autophagy reduces cellular inflammation.
